Dr. Eustis, Veterinarian

   On Tuesday, October 30th, Dr. Eustis visited our classroom to meet with our second grade team.  Dr. Eustis is a South Burlington community member.  He also serves the community by taking care of our animals. 
   Dr. Eustis asked the children, "What do you think a veterinarian does to help the community?"   He spoke about how vets help protect the public.  They help prevent people from getting many diseases.  In addition to taking care of sick or injured animals, vets watch out for diseases that can get into the population.
   We learned a lot about what veterinarians do to help animals and people.  We saw x-rays of various animals, asked many questions, and used various pieces of equipment that a vet must use like an otoscope to check ears and a stethoscope to listen to heartbeats.
